Abstract:
A non-real time stereoscopic video service method and apparatus are provided. The non-real time stereoscopic video service method performed by a reception apparatus, including: extracting a program association table (PAT) from a received transport stream (TS) and analyzing the same; extracting a program map table (PMT) corresponding to a program selected by a user from the PAT and analyzing the same; extracting a stereoscopic video service descriptor from the PMT and analyzing the same; generating frame and/or time information of an image to be reproduced according to the analysis of the stereoscopic video service descriptor; and reproducing an image by synchronizing a reference image and a supplementary image based on the generated frame and/or time information.
Abstract:
Provided is an apparatus and method for transmitting and receiving broadcasting data and supplementary data. The method includes: generating broadcasting data and supplementary data for a plurality of predetermined 3D broadcasting services to be provided to users; multiplexing the generated broadcasting data for broadcasting channels respectively allocated to the plurality of predetermined 3D broadcasting services, and multiplexing the generated supplementary data for one commonly broadcasting channel commonly allocated to the plurality of predetermined 3D broadcasting services; encoding the multiplexed supplementary data corresponding to a conditional access system; and transmitting the encoded supplementary data to the one common broadcasting channel, and transmitting the multiplexed broadcasting data to the allocated broadcasting channels.
Abstract:
Provided is a stereoscopic video service providing method using a stereoscopic video stream including first and second video streams in a digital broadcasting system. The stereoscopic video service providing method includes: generating information on the first video stream and information on the second video stream; inserting an identifier of the information on the second video stream into the information on the first video stream; and transmitting the first video stream and the information on the first video stream and the second video stream and the information on the second video stream through separate transmission channels, respectively.
Abstract:
A method and apparatus for processing enhanced media data in a Digital Multimedia Broadcasting (DMB) system is provided. The apparatus for processing enhanced media data includes: a base layer processing unit configured to multiplex an elementary stream of a base layer and perform channel encoding for the multiplexed elementary stream of the base layer; an enhancement layer processing unit configured to synchronize an elementary stream of an enhancement layer with the elementary stream of the base layer and thereby multiplex the elementary stream of the enhancement layer and process the elementary stream of the enhancement layer to be transmittable via at least one of a plurality of transmission channels; and a synchronizer configured to provide the enhancement layer processing unit with synchronization information that is used for synchronizing the elementary stream of the enhancement layer with the elementary stream of the base layer.
Abstract:
Provided is a method and system for transmitting/receiving broadcasting service. The method for transmitting a 3-dimensional broadcasting service includes: encoding a reference image and an additional image of the 3-dimensional broadcasting service to generate a reference image stream and an additional image stream; receiving a service map table defining the 3-dimensional broadcasting service; and transmitting the reference image stream, the additional image stream and the service map table in real time.
Abstract:
A method and apparatus for providing 3D still image service in a specific time interval during audio-visual service of digital broadcast are provided. The method includes receiving a reference image and a 3D supplement image, which construct a 3D still image, through a data channel or a video channel together with a 2D image; restoring the reference image and the 3D supplement image to the 3D still image; and displaying the 3D still image in a specific interval during digital audio-visual broadcast using the 2D image according to display information which includes a play time and a play mode.
